Output 26d28cdc33d85c3ec609fe7dfd71c7437242f69dadd15c2a72afa6884a4fa09e:0

value
1606785
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0119c3db8bf669da9e9d28a83cc0100bef0d1b30 OP_EQUAL
address
31nqTvYQfYPP28Uf3DzWTsGQXxc8vc55Dw
transaction
26d28cdc33d85c3ec609fe7dfd71c7437242f69dadd15c2a72afa6884a4fa09e
confirmations
316326
spent
true